Abstract

A cylindrical battery, as one example according to an embodiment of the present disclosure, is provided with: an electrode body formed by spirally winding a positive electrode and a negative electrode with a separator interposed therebetween; and a bottomed cylindrical exterior can for accommodating the electrode body. The negative electrode has a negative-electrode core body and a negative-electrode mixture layer provided on a surface of the negative-electrode core body. An exposed area in which the surface of the negative-electrode core body is exposed is formed on an outer circumferential surface of the electrode body, and the exposed area is in contact with the inner surface of the exterior can. The negative-electrode mixture layer contains, as a negative-electrode active material, graphite particles having an internal porosity of 5% or less and a fracture strength of 25-55 MPa.

Claims (7)

1. A cylindrical battery, comprising:

an electrode assembly having a positive electrode and a negative electrode wound into a spiral shape with a separator intervening therebetween; and

a bottomed cylindrical exterior can housing the electrode assembly, wherein

the negative electrode has a negative electrode core, and a negative electrode mixture layer provided on a surface of the negative electrode core,

an exposed part from which a surface of the negative electrode core is exposed is formed on an outer peripheral surface of the electrode assembly, and the exposed part is in contact with an inner surface of the exterior can, and

the negative electrode mixture layer includes, as a negative electrode active material, graphite particles having 5% or less of internal porosity and 25 MPa to 55 MPa of breaking strength.

2. The cylindrical battery according to claim 1 , wherein the negative electrode mixture layer includes 15 mass % or more of the graphite particles relative to a total mass of the negative electrode active material.
